Knox County slave register, James Ford registers Fanny, 1807

Description: On Sept. 23, 1806 James Ford comes before Isaac White, Deputy Clerk of the Knox County Clerk of Common Pleas and brings a Negro woman named Fanny age 20. She is a slave belonging to James Ford and was brought here from the state of Kentucky. Fanny’s previous owner was George Vann. James Ford is to provide Fanny with proper lodging, clothing and washing provisions. At the end of thirty years of service Fanny is not to become a county charge.
